Cyclone

1 article · Astronomy & Space · Wikipedia

A cyclone is a large rotating storm system characterized by strong winds that spiral inward toward a low-pressure center, creating a powerful and often destructive weather phenomenon. These storms form over warm ocean waters and are known by different regional names—hurricanes in the Atlantic and eastern Pacific, typhoons in the western Pacific, and cyclones in the Indian Ocean and South Pacific—but they're all the same type of intense tropical weather system. Cyclones can cause tremendous damage through extreme winds, heavy rainfall, and storm surge, making them among the most dangerous natural disasters on Earth.
